Why buy an Approved Used Mercedes-Benz EQS?
One of the first vehicles from Mercedes-Benz to be built on dedicated EV architecture, the EQS stands out for its all-electric capabilities and cutting-edge technology. Having been designed from the ground up (rather than leveraging a pre-existing platform designed for traditionally-powered cars), the EQS has a more efficient layout, improved aerodynamics, and enhanced safety features to cement its place as one of the best EVs currently available.
Offered with either a single rear-wheel drive motor or dual motors for all-wheel-drive, the EQS is an excellent choice for both urban driving and longer-range commutes, making it ideal for differing lifestyles. Used cars fitted with the 4MATIC all-wheel drive system will also make trickier conditions such as snow and ice that bit easier.
Power outputs range from 355bhp to 658bhp, resulting in 0 to 62mph acceleration times between 6.2 and 4.5 seconds, depending on the model. For those seeking even more performance, Mercedes-Benz also offers a high-powered AMG version of the EQS, producing up to 761bhp and capable of accelerating to 62mph in just 3.4 seconds from resting.
Inside, the cabin is spacious, modern, and luxurious, featuring high-quality materials and up-to-date technology. The information system is housed within Mercedes-Benz' impressive MBUX environment and is presented on a 17.7-inch touchscreen positioned at the centre of the dashboard.

The letters ‘EQ’ stand for Electric Intelligence, signifying that the EQS is part of Mercedes-Benz electric vehicle range. The ‘S’ denotes the model’s position within the line-up, indicating that the EQS is one of the most luxurious vehicles in the EQ family.
When properly maintained according to Mercedes-Benz’ recommended service schedule, Mercedes-Benz' battery warranty will be in-place for 10 years or 250,000 kilometres (from the vehicle's production date). However, this is only Mercedes-Benz' guarantee, so it is likely the battery could last longer than that, too.
The exact cost of insuring your EQS can vary significantly depending on the insurance provider, as well as the vehicle’s age and mileage. However, as the EQS is considered a premium vehicle, it falls into insurance group 50, the highest category, making it expensive to insure.
